Small dent..... How much to get fixed???
I have a small dent on my pass side front fender... right on the flare.... Its about an 1/2inch 1inch big.... It's nothing really, you can't even really tell its there unless you look.... Just wondering because its on the flare itself... it would be kind of hard to get fixed.... has anyone had this done by a body shop??? and how much would it cost?

<TABLE WIDTH="90%" CELLSPACING=0 CELLPADDING=0 ALIGN=CENTER><TR><TD>Quote, originally posted by Drunk-N-Munky »</TD></TR><TR><TD CLASS="quote">take it to a paintless dent removal place.... average about $50 </TD></TR></TABLE>
That is what I always do. Usually costs around here $60-$80 depending on where the dent is at. I just put a ding in my front quarter panel when I was taking out my motor last week, I'm taking it in on Monday to have it fixed, if the car is running.
Carsmetics actually does a good job at ding removal, despite what people say about them.
